本文将,深入分析其开发流程及技术应用。首先介绍东辽app的背景及应用需求,然后分析其开发过程中所使用的前端技术,如HTML、CSS、JavaScript等。其次,重点探讨后台开发技术和数据库设计,如Java、MySQL等。最后,本文还将着重讨论安全性和性能优化方面的技术应用,以及未来趋势和发展方向。
一、 东辽app的背景及应用需求
东辽app是基于地理信息及实时数据采集开发的移动应用程序,旨在为当地居民提供便捷的生活服务和信息查询。其开发需求主要包含以下内容:
1. 实时采集当地天气、交通、旅游、房产等各类信息。
2. 提供在线支付、办事指南、社区论坛等功能服务。
3. 保证应用程序稳定性和安全性、快速响应和数据安全。
二、 前端技术在东辽app中的应用
前端技术在移动应用程序中扮演着至关重要的角色,它关乎用户体验和性能优化。东辽app在前端开发中主要使用以下技术:
1. HTML5:用于页面结构的布局和展示,具有灵活性和兼容性等特点。
2. CSS3:用于页面样式的设计和美化,能够实现元素动画等效果。
3. JavaScript:用于动态交互和数据处理,能够实现实时响应和动态渲染等特效。
三、 后台开发技术和数据库设计的优化
后台开发技术和数据库设计是东辽app的核心,它关系到系统性能和稳定性。在此方面,东辽app主要采用以下技术:
1. Java框架:用于后台业务逻辑处理及接口开发,具有高效性和可扩展性。
2. MySQL数据库:用于数据存储和管理,能够提供高性能和可靠的数据服务。
3. Redis缓存:用于数据读取和缓存,能够提供快速响应和高性能的数据服务。
四、 安全性和性能优化方面的技术应用
安全性和性能优化是移动应用程序必须重视的方面,它关系到用户数据的安全和系统运行的稳定性。在此方面,东辽app采用以下技术:
1. SSL/TLS协议:保证数据传输的安全性和私密性。
2. OAauth2.0协议:提供用户身份认证和权限控制,保证数据的安全性。
3. CDN加速:用于数据传输和资源加载,能够提供快速响应和高效率的用户体验。
五、 东辽app的未来趋势和发展方向
移动应用程序是一个快速发展和变化的领域,在未来的发展中,东辽app可能实现以下发展方向:
1. 人工智能技术的应用,实现自动化处理和服务提供。
2. 区块链技术的应用,实现数据交易和安全验证。
3. VR/AR技术的应用,实现全新的用户体验和应用场景。
本文通过对东辽app程序高级研发技术的探秘,深入分析了其开发过程中所使用的技术应用和优化方案。在未来的发展中,随着新技术的应用和发展,东辽app将会更加智能、高效、安全和稳定,为用户提供更好的体验和服务。
本文主要探讨了东辽app的高级研发技术。首先介绍了东辽app的背景和功能,之后讲解了东辽app的架构和开发工具。接着阐述了需求分析和设计模式,最后探讨了代码优化和测试策略。本文详细介绍了东辽app高级研发技术,对于程序开发人员有很大的参考价值。
1. 东辽app的背景和功能
东辽app是针对东北地区的一个区域性生活服务类app,主要提供餐饮、购物、旅游等方面的服务。使用者可以通过东辽app查找附近的商铺、餐馆、景点等,并进行下单或预约。为了更好的服务于用户,东辽app还提供了会员积分、预订优惠等多种便民服务。
2. 东辽app的架构和开发工具
东辽app采用的是MVC架构模式,由Model(数据模型)、View(用户界面)和Controller(控制器)三部分组成。Model和View之间采用Observer(观察者)模式,Controller接受并处理用户的请求,对Model和View进行必要的调整。
在开发过程中,东辽app所用到的开发工具有Eclipse、Android Studio等,使用Java、SQL等编程语言进行开发。通过Maven、Git等工具进行代码管理和构建。
3. 需求分析和设计模式
在东辽app的开发中,需求分析是非常重要的环节。需求分析通过调研用户需求,完成系统需求和用户需求之间的转化,进而完成系统架构设计。
在设计模式方面,东辽app主要采用的是工厂模式、单例模式、代理模式等。通过设计模式的使用,可以大大提升代码的可读性和可维护性。
4. 代码优化和测试策略
针对东辽app的代码优化和测试策略,主要采用的策略有代码重构、性能测试、自动化测试等。这些策略可以大大提升代码的质量和稳定性,从而为用户提供更加完善的体验。
本文详细介绍了东辽app的高级研发技术。从开发工具、系统架构、设计模式、代码优化和测试策略等多个方面进行阐述。相信这些技术对于程序开发人员有很大的参考价值。